If you are interested in wildlife photography, one of the most vital wildlife photography tips is to extensively research the animals you are hoping to capture on camera, as people like Danny Green would certainly validate. After all, wild animals are their own creatures, so it is essential to learn all their common patterns, routiines and habits so that you can interpret their behaviours. Make sure to stay back, lay low and make no noise; not only does this make it simpler to capture the picture, however it likewise doesn't disturb or intimidate the animal. Being respectful to the animal and their habitat is extremely important to getting the best shot and preserving the balance of nature.

If this is something that you have an interest in, one of the most crucial landscape photography tips is to find out how to work with the natural light. Usually, the best time to capture landscape images is throughout golden hour, whether it's during dawn or sunset. This is due to the fact that the light typically is much softer and warmer, making it the ideal conditions for capturing striking images. As a landscape photographer, you should pay attention to how the light is affecting the scene and recognize what camera setting will generate the best photo.

One of the most remarkable styles of nature photography is undersea photography. A lot of the ocean is unknown to individuals; undersea photography shows people the whole other world that exists in our seas, ranging from the vibrant coral reefs to stunning marine life. In regards to how to do underwater photography, the initial step is actually obtaining your scuba diving licence. This is to make sure that you are able to utilize the breathing apparatus and scuba equipment conveniently and confidently. As soon as you are a strong scuba diver, you can then do a training course in underwater photography, as people like Shane Gross would certainly verify.
